Application to Enrich Rare
Cell Populations - with Fewer Steps
EpiSep™ device for
characterization of breast and lymph node metastasis, stem
cell, and many other applications.
In a few rapid and simple steps
harvest pure populations from tissue, blood, and marrow for
use in cell culture, flow analysis or molecular analysis.

As can be
seen from this process, cells are released from the magnetic
capture particles in a manner that allows for further processing
(such as flow cytometry analysis) free of interference.
